Internal video clip production involves producing video clip material making use of a firm's inner group and resources. Greater control over the manufacturing procedure and brand name messaging. Faster turn-around times for alterations and task completion. Cost-effective for organizations with recurring video clip web content requirements. Calls for significant financial investment in tools, modern technology, and competent personnel. May lack specialized experience in particular aspects of video clip manufacturing.
Outsourced video manufacturing involves working with exterior firms or consultants to create video content. Accessibility to experienced specialists with specialized skills and proficiency. Greater imaginative input and fresh viewpoints on tasks. Scalability and adaptability to manage tasks of differing dimensions and complexities. Greater expenses contrasted to in-house manufacturing, especially for smaller projects.
Longer timelines because of control with exterior teams. When you discover a company or organization that has a need, you have actually cut your sales pitch in fifty percent. My very first client at first rejected my sales pitch.
I was eager for job samples to build out my portfolio, so I offered to do a project free of cost. I finished that job, he rolled the video clip out, and instantly he had an abundance of candidates. His point of view on the worth of video clip quickly transformed, and within a month settled on a year-long contract to create a selection of video clip web content.
My production package was constructed out to be lean, active, and effective. I favored smaller sized cameras, small illumination services, and made every effort to fit my entire production package into a knapsack. Now, this lean set method isn't for everybody. When you stroll into a shoot with a customer who is anticipating instances of devices carried by an expansive staff, and all you brought is a knapsack and yourself, well, that may have them inspecting back on their invoice to see what they're spending for in your services.
I invested a considerable quantity of time promoting that technique to my prospective clients by placing myself as a lean and effective alternative to the "three ring circus" that much of them experienced with past video production jobs that they had taken component in. It is necessary to note that the success of this approach pivots on providing a first-class final product.
If your deliverables fade in comparison, after that they will aim to your production style as the perpetrator. Once the pandemic hit in 2020, my sales pitch concerning a "tiny footprint" was a lot less relevant when every person was looking for "no footprint. Making video production much easier and a lot more seamless resonated with our customers, so our ideology as a service started leaning more right into that.
Being receptive to changing situations will certainly aid you learn undiscovered region and expand your company gradually.
